Margaret Mary "Peggi" (McIntyre) Gedutis, age 86, of South Weymouth, Massachusetts, passed away peacefully on June 21, 2025.

Born on July 3, 1938 in Dorchester, Massachusetts, Peggi was the cherished daughter of the late Daniel A. and Margaret M. (Johnson) McIntyre. She grew up in Dorchester surrounded by the love of her family and carried that devotion into every chapter of her life. Peggi and her family moved to Weymouth during her senior year of high school. She graduated in 1956 from Dorchester High School and went to work as a secretary for Saab Motors.

After raising her children, Peggi dedicated many years as the office manager for Gedutis Plumbing in Weymouth. Her attention to detail and steadfast work ethic were instrumental to the business’s success. She also worked as a secretary for the late Dr. Robert DiTullio in Quincy, where she was known for her warm demeanor and welcoming presence.

At the heart of Peggi’s life was her family. She shared a loving marriage with her devoted husband of 63 years, William L. Gedutis. Together they built a beautiful home filled with love, strength and laughter. Peggi was always a thoroughly devoted mother to Wayne W. Gedutis and his wife Leslie Lilla of Las Vegas, Nevada; Laura A. (Gedutis) LeBarron and her husband Jim of South Weymouth; and Kevin W. Gedutis and his wife Rose West of Rockland.

Her grandchildren were her heart and soul. She was the sweetest, sassiest and most supportive Nana to Brett, Maggie, and Tess LeBarron and Daniel and William Gedutis. Her grandchildren brought immense happiness and joy to her life. Peggi’s love for them was boundless; she celebrated their milestones with pride and supported them in all of their many pursuits with unwavering affection.

A lifelong animal lover, Peggi shared her home over the years with several beloved spoiled cats and great dogs who brought her companionship, love and comfort. She leaves behind her treasured black cat Vader, who remained faithfully by her side.

Peggi was predeceased by her parents as well as her brothers Daniel and John McIntrye and sister and best friend Patricia (McIntyre) Pace.

Those who knew Peggi will remember her as a constant source of love and support—for her children, grandchildren, friends, and all whose lives she touched with kindness, sassiness and a smile.

May her memory bring comfort to those lucky enough to have known and loved her.
